George Joseph Hill Jr., 59, of Meadville, formerly of Espyville, Pa, passed away unexpectedly, on Thursday, November 6, 2014, at his residence.

Born February 3, 1955, in Youngstown, Ohio, he was the son of George and Linda Nocera Hill.  He was also the step-son of Anthony J. Diana.

He graduated from East High School in Youngstown and then attended Youngstown State University.

George recently retired as a self-employed electrician and handyman.  He was a member of the Fraternal Order of the Eagles and the Italian Civic Club both in Meadville.

Survivors include a sister, Mary Anne Seaman and her husband, Bob, of Andover; a niece, Geniene Hankey and her husband, Thomas, of Youngstown; a nephew, Thomas Chizmar Jr. of Lakewood, Ohio; two great-nephews, Anson and Aidan Hankey; his former wife, Dora Hill; and many close cousins.

He was preceded in death by his parents and step-father .

George loved the Pymatuning Lake area and convinced his step-father and mother to purchase a lot in Tuttle Allotment for his graduation gift.  Eventually they put a home on the property and moved there from Youngstown.  George was the “life of the party”.  His family was the most important part of his life.  He spent a great deal of time with his family and there wasn’t anything he wouldn’t do for them.
